Am Sat, 08 Oct 2016 20:23:09 +0200 schrieb Yegor Yefremov:
> isn't mwclient Python 3 compatible? See [1]
>
> [1] https://github.com/mwclient/mwclient/blob/master/setup.py#L48
Hi Yegor,
using this defconfig
BR2_TOOLCHAIN_BUILDROOT_WCHAR=y
BR2_PACKAGE_PYTHON3=y
BR2_PACKAGE_PYTHON_MWCLIENT=y
this error occurs with plain make:
-------------------------------------------------
>>> Finalizing target directory
PYTHONPATH="/home/buildroot/br3_couchdb/output/target/usr/lib/python3.5/
sysconfigdata/:/home/buildroot/br3_couchdb/output/target/usr/lib/
python3.5/site-packages/" /home/buildroot/br3_couchdb/output/host/usr/bin/
python3.5 support/scripts/pycompile.py /home/buildroot/br3_couchdb/output/
target/usr/lib/python3.5
Traceback (most recent call last):
File "/home/buildroot/br3_couchdb/output/host/usr/lib/python3.5/
py_compile.py", line 125, in compile
_optimize=optimize)
File "<frozen importlib._bootstrap_external>", line 700, in
source_to_code
File "<frozen importlib._bootstrap>", line 222, in
_call_with_frames_removed
File "/home/buildroot/br3_couchdb/output/target/usr/lib/python3.5/site-
packages/mwclient/ex.py", line 15
exec _file in globals(), predata
^
SyntaxError: invalid syntax
-------------------------------------------------
This error does not occur with python2.
